This is some art inspired by something very good that happened Saturday when I was in the meditation portion of my breathing exercises my therapist recommended me to last year. I spend a good long time in meditation. I got so deep into that state that for the first time in my life my mind was actually still. There were no random thoughts and clutter from the ADHD not anxiety and worries from my Generalized Anxiety disorder. My mind was in absolute silence. It literally felt like my soul was still. If you have not been in this state before you have no idea how good it feels. It’s not the “YIPPEEEE! I won the lottery!’ Kind of happy where you return to your emotional baseline after that euphoria. This was more of being content, and ease, in an absolute state of peace. This just encourages me to meditate even more.
